A pre-trial settlement conference is where you compare your settlement drafts and narrow the issues for trial. You may find you're close enough on the remaining issues to hit a compromise then and there or soon thereafter. If there aren't any issues that the judge needs to decide, then you'll be scheduled for a stipulated divorce hearing (a quick rubber stamp in no-fault states). If there are issues, a trial is scheduled and you go ahead.
You may have had a few status conferences and calendar hearings and other procedural stuff...
